What is recorded here

In low-lying pasture, liable to flooding. Roughly rectangular-shaped area (42m N-S; 23m E-W) enclosed by earthen bank (H 0.5m). Bank partly levelled E to S. Antiquity unknown. The above description has been derived from D. Lavelle (compiler), An Archaeological Survey of Ballinrobe and District including Lough Mask and Lough Carra. Lough Mask and Lough Carra Tourist Development Association (1994), No. 354. Date of upload: 3 February 2014
